Pistons fans everywhere were ecstatic when it was revealed that the Detroit Pistons will have the first pick in the 2021 NBA Draft.

This is the first time since 1970, and only the third time in franchise history, that the Pistons will pick first. The last time we had the first pick, it turned out alright as the team drafted Hall of Famer, Bob Lanier. Ben Wallace was representing the Pistons last night when the announcement was made. Initially he just held up the number one sign, and leaned back in disbelief, but he opened up talking to ESPN afterward.

So what will the Pistons do with the number one pick in 2021?

Most NBA experts think that Detroit will be targeting Oklahoma State Point Guard, Cade Cunningham. Cunningham has everything that the Pistons are looking for right now, and is the best overall player in the draft.

There are a few other names that have been thrown out there for the first pick including:

  • Evan Mobley from USC
  • Jalen Suggs from Gonzaga
  • Jalen Green from the G League
  • Jon Kuminga from the G League

While the Pistons have not said for sure who they are targeting, most fans and NBA analysts think Cunningham is the clear favorite.
